Dependent HTML5 sliders
A various amount of HTML input range fields that are connected to each other, and will automatically correct the others when one is changed.

JavaScript
var elements = document.querySelectorAll('input');
var length = elements.length;
var sliders = Array.prototype.slice.call(elements); // Copy of `elements` but as a real array
var max = 100;
function change(current) {
"use strict";
set(current);
var input = +current.value;
var delta = max - input;
var sum = 0;
var siblings = [];
// Sum of all siblings
sliders.forEach(function (slider) {
if (current != slider) {
siblings.push(slider); // Register as sibling
sum += +slider.value;
}
});
// Update all the siblings
var partial = 0;
siblings.forEach(function (slider, i) {
var val = +slider.value;
var fraction = 0;
// Calculate fraction
if (sum <= 0) {
fraction = 1 / (length - 1)
} else {
fraction = val / sum;
}
// The last element will correct rounding errors
if (i >= length - 1) {
val = max - partial;
} else {
val = Math.round(delta * fraction);
partial += val;
}
set(slider, val);
});
}
// Set value on a slider
function set(elm, val) {
if (val) {
elm.value = val;
}
// Hack to trigger CSS ::after content to be updated
elm.setAttribute('value', elm.value);
}
// Add event listeners to the DOM elements
for (var i = 0, l = elements.length; i < l; i++) {
elements[i].addEventListener('change', function (e) {
change(this);
}, false);
}
